Form 4: ADT Inc. CEO Acquires 3,681,118 Stock Options
SEC Form 4 Filing
ADT Inc. CEO James David DeVries reports the acquisition of 3,681,118 employee stock options.
Summary
- James David DeVries, Chairman, President & CEO of ADT Inc., filed a Form 4 on March 6, 2025, reporting a transaction that occurred on March 4, 2025.
- The transaction involved the acquisition of 3,681,118 employee stock options with an exercise price of $7.59.
- These options vest in three equal increments on March 4, 2026, March 4, 2027, and March 4, 2028.
- Following the transaction, DeVries directly owns 3,681,118 derivative securities (employee stock options).

Key Dates
| Date | Description |
|---|---|
| 03/04/2025 | Date of earliest transaction: Acquisition of stock options. |
| 03/04/2026 | First vesting date for the stock options. |
| 03/04/2027 | Second vesting date for the stock options. |
| 03/04/2028 | Third vesting date for the stock options. |
| 03/04/2035 | Expiration date for the stock options. |
| 03/06/2025 | Date of Form 4 filing. |
